Step back in time at the WWII German Gun Battery, a historical landmark in Jersey that offers an intriguing glimpse into the island's military past. This impressive relic showcases the strategic importance of Jersey during World War II, with its formidable gun emplacements and stunning coastal views. Ideal for history enthusiasts and casual tourists alike, the site provides a unique opportunity to learn about the island's wartime history while enjoying the beautiful scenery.

- Visit early in the morning or late in the afternoon for fewer crowds and better lighting for photography.
- Wear comfortable shoes, as the terrain can be uneven and rocky in several areas.
- Don't forget your camera; the sweeping coastal views are perfect for memorable photographs.
- Check the weather forecast before your visit, as strong winds can affect your experience at the coastal site.
- Take time to read the informational displays to gain a deeper understanding of the site's historical context.
